Matt's correct, if you're using density fields that come from cic_deposit, the particle "masses" are already actually densities, so the dx^3 has already been divided out.  It's probably not a given that all codes will store the particle masses as densities, so it is probably worth it to make those enzo specific.

> It appears from a cursory look at the source code that CICDeposit_3 does not automatically convert the mapped "mass" to a density itself... that the volume must be divided by after the fact. Is this correct?

Britton might have more to say about this (as he wrote CICDeposit_3)
but I believe you are correct in some cases.  The Enzo field
particle_mass is actually a density, name notwithstanding.  From my
reading of the field definitions, CICDeposit_3 shows up in these
fields, where the parenthetical note is the type of field:

particle_density (universal)
star_density (enzo)
dm_density (enzo)
star_metallicity_fraction (via star_field) (enzo)
star_creation_time (via star_field) (enzo)
star_dynamical_time (via star_field) (enzo)

As long as particle_mass is defined as a density (and looking at
yt/frontends/flash/fields.py, I see that there it is not) this should
work fine for the particle_density field.  The last field, star_field,
is the only one that doesn't use exclusively particle_mass, and it is
careful about depositing both the field requested and then dividing by
the particle mass deposited, giving a weighted average.

I think perhaps a good solution here would be to move particle_density
to being Enzo specific, and then having individual codes define their
own version of those fields, to avoid any problems.  What do you
think?
